Abstract

Cloud-based cybersecurity frameworks have emerged as crucial components in ensuring the
efficiency and security of healthcare information technology (IT) systems. This paper explores the
application of cloud-based cybersecurity frameworks in enhancing the efficiency of healthcare IT
operations while safeguarding sensitive patient data. By leveraging cloud-based solutions,
healthcare organizations can achieve scalable and robust cybersecurity measures, effectively
mitigating evolving cyber threats and compliance challenges. This study investigates various
cloud-based cybersecurity frameworks, their implementation strategies, and the potential benefits
they offer to healthcare IT systems. Through a comprehensive analysis of case studies and industry
best practices, this paper elucidates the role of cloud-based cybersecurity frameworks in
optimizing healthcare IT efficiency and resilience against cyber threats.
